What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temporary Splunk Administrator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Temporary Splunk Administrator, you need a solid understanding of IT systems, data analysis, and Splunk platform management, often supported by experience with system administration or security operations. Familiarity with Splunk Enterprise, SPL (Search Processing Language), and relevant certifications like Splunk Core Certified User or Power User are typically required. Strong problem-solving, communication, and adaptability help you address urgent issues and collaborate with diverse teams. These skills ensure efficient log management, quick incident response, and the effective use of Splunk to support organizational security and operations.

What does a Temporary Splunk professional do?

A Temporary Splunk professional is hired on a short-term basis to manage, configure, and optimize Splunk software within an organization. Their responsibilities typically include setting up data ingestion, developing dashboards and alerts, troubleshooting issues, and ensuring data security and compliance within the Splunk environment. They may also assist in training staff, automating workflows, and integrating Splunk with other tools. Temporary Splunk hires are often brought in for specific projects, migrations, or to cover staffing gaps.
